Abstract
Abstract: One-lung ventilation (OLV) is standard during thoracic surgery, but maintaining adequate oxygenation can be particularly challenging in patients with prior contralateral lobectomy. We report the case of a 44-year-old woman undergoing uniportal video-assisted thoracic surgery (uVATS) right upper lobectomy after a previous left upper lobectomy. Severe hypoxemia occurred during OLV despite maximal ventilatory adjustments and the application of conventional continuous positive airway pressure (CPAP) to the operative lung, which impaired surgical exposure. As a rescue strategy, a bronchial blocker was inserted through a left-sided double-lumen tube (DLT) into the right bronchus intermedius, enabling selective CPAP delivery to the right middle and lower lobes while maintaining collapse of the right upper lobe. This approach successfully restored oxygenation without interfering with the surgical field. This case illustrates that the combined use of a DLT and bronchial blocker can provide an effective and safe solution for refractory hypoxemia, and can be considered as a rescue technique in complex thoracic procedures after contralateral resections.
